‘It has to pass in order for things to just keep going, not to get better’: Hannibal public safety tax to be put to a vote on Tuesday
HANNIBAL — Hannibal voters will head to the polls Tuesday to decide the fate of Proposition 1, which would authorize the city to enact a sales tax of up to one-half percent for the purpose of improving public safety if approved.
